ZWSF03 Cyproconazole
Specification:95%TC
CAS NO.: 94361-06-5
Chemical name: α-(4-chlorophenyl)-α-(1-cyclopropylethyl)-1H-1,2,4-triazol-1-ethanol
Structure Formula:
Molecular Formula: C15H18ClN3O
Physical chemistry: Composition:It is a mixture (c.1:1) of 2 diastereoisomers.Form:Colourless solid. M.p.: 106-109 ℃ B.p.: >250 ℃ V.p.: 3.46 × 10-2 mPa (20 ℃) Henry: S.g./density: 1.259 g/cm3 Solubility: In water 140 mg/l (25 ℃). Application: Biochemistry: Steroid demethylation inhibitor. Mode of action: Systemic fungicide with protective, curative, and eradicant action. Absorbed rapidly by the plant, with translocation acropetally. Uses: Systemic fungicide effective against a broad range of diseases. Cereal and sugar beet foliar diseases: Septoria, rust, powdery mildew, Rhynchosporium, Cercospora, Ramularia at 60-100 g a.i./ha. In fruit trees, vines, coffee, banana, turf, vegetables: Venturia, powdery mildew, rust, Mycosphaerella, Monilia, Mycena, Sclerotinia, Rhizoctonia.
